Deduction of Assessment Items about Applied Technologies in U-Eco City

Abstract
For assessment of U-Eco City technologies, more concrete definition of those technologies are required. However, almost researches defined technologies as conceptually and even cannot include all of them. In this sense, the purpose of this study is to deduct assessing items for specifying applying priority of U-Eco City technologies. We performed the research by 3 steps. Firstly, we deduct assessing items of the technologies by researching their advance process. After then, we compensate the defect of those items through documentary research and made a periodic table about core technologies that can be useful for deducting long-term items. The assessing items what are deducted as a result of this study can be applied to the selection of technology, and will be useful to construct more objective and systematized U-Eco City. Furthermore, if assessment frame about technologies and services is developed from this research, it gives to us probability that standardized process of U-Eco City construction can be established.
